The Bailey Ground Lodge is situated in the village of Seascale, offering views over the sandy beach and the Irish Sea. Nearby, the scenic Seascale Golf Club provides a renowned links course for golf enthusiasts. The lodge is conveniently located a short walk from the train station with direct connections to Carlisle and Barrow.

Questions of the users
About Bailey Ground Lodge
Are there any superior double rooms located on the ground floor?
12 November 2024
Yes, there are two superior double rooms available on the ground floor.
Is it possible to bring my dog along when staying in a superior double room?
20 January 2025
Yes, dogs are allowed in superior double rooms at an additional charge of £10 per stay.
Can I bring my two small dogs with me during my stay?
5 March 2025
Yes, you can bring your small dogs along, with a fee of £10 per pet for the duration of your stay.
Does the Lodge offer any food services, such as breakfast or dinner?
15 February 2025
Currently, the Lodge does not serve breakfast, but evening meals can be enjoyed at the nearby Bailey Ground Hotel.
